What are the top historical places and other sights to visit in Literary Quarter?
Literary Quarter is notable for its monuments and landmarks like Fountain of Neptune, Paseo del Prado, and Calle de Alcalá. Known for its museums, cultural venues include Thyssen-Bornemisza National Museum, Paseo del Arte, and Teatro Espanol. Puerta del Sol is another popular sight to explore.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
These are quite similar. "Histor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S., while you'll often hear "heritage hotel" in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to put more importance on the architecture and actual building. Mainly heritage hotels draw meaning from the cultural value and how it inspired the community.
